  • I had an Americano from Second Cup (not this location) the morning after I first arrived in Canada. A few sips in, I texted my coffee guru friend back home saying that the coffee in Canada was crap! Thankfully, my opinion on Canadian coffee has improved greatly in the year that's passed, but I stand by my opinion on Second Cup's espresso. Their brewed coffee, however, is very nice in comparison. I had never tried their food before, so while running errands in Scotia Plaza this morning, I decided to forgo my Starbucks or Tim Horton's breakfast sandwich and try a similar option from Second Cup instead. I noticed that the ham and cheese sandwich I picked up was noticeably smaller than the Starbucks equivalent, but for the exact same price. I didn't have time on my short break to overly think about my choice however, so went ahead and got it. The three (?!) staff members who dealt with my simple request for one item did not smile, and none of them said please or thank you. The sandwich was very underwhelming and the ham tasted really, really greasy. I've worked in the industry before and am under no illusions about how overly processed these things are and how disgustingly far in advance they are made. However, at least the competing breakfast options at Starbucks and Timmie's taste amazing. The slimy ham and boring, soggy bread of the Second Cup option however, tasted as unhealthy and generic as its means of preparation and shipping.
